30 Rock star Tracy Morgan is headed to the Keswick Theatre, Saturday, May 19 at 8 p.m. Tickets go on sale this Saturday, March 24 at noon. They’re sure to be swiped up quickly, so we wanted to give you a heads up. You probably know the former SNL star as Tracy Jordan on Tina Fey’s Emmy and Golden Globe-winning 30 Rock. He’s hilarious and will undoubtedly deliver his trademark anything-can-happen comedy for a night you won’t want to miss. Get tickets online starting this Saturday. [Keswick Theatre]
